1.keil怎么找到编译错误处
2.用C++6.0生成DLL 源码有错误怎么找错误的源码准确地方
3.如何查找程序的错误
keil怎么找到编译错误处
在Keil中找到编译错误处,可以按照以下步骤进行操作:
在Keil的错误输出窗口中查看编译错误信息。当编译出现错误时,位置Keil会在输出窗口中显示错误信息,源码包括错误类型、错误错误行数和错误描述等。位置lpsolve 源码您可以根据这些信息来定位错误所在的源码位置。
在Keil的错误源代码窗口中查看错误行数。根据输出窗口中显示的位置错误行数,您可以在源代码窗口中找到对应的源码行数,并检查该行代码是错误否存在语法错误或其他问题。
使用Keil的位置调试功能进行调试。如果您无法确定错误所在位置,源码可以使用Keil的错误调试功能进行调试。在调试过程中,位置您可以逐步执行代码,并观察程序运行情况,从而找到错误所在位置。
查看Keil生成的神采飞扬源码编译报告。在编译完成后,Keil会生成一个编译报告,其中包括编译过程中的详细信息和错误列表。您可以查看该报告,从而找到编译错误所在位置。
以上是几种常见的找到编译错误处的方法,希望能对您有所帮助。
用C++6.0生成DLL 源码有错误怎么找错误的准确地方
你说的是调试吗?
VC6中好像很难调试dll。
不过可以换成以及以上版本。mud海洋2源码
启动包含dll的应用程序后,选择调式菜单中的附加到进程(attach),选择包含dll的文件就行了
如何查找程序的错误
查找程序中的错误是编程过程中的关键任务。以下是一些常见的策略和步骤用于识别和修复程序中的错误(又称为“bug”):理解代码逻辑:在查找错误之前,彻底理解代码的逻辑和流程非常重要。这包括对算法和数据结构的理解。
逐行检查代码:缓慢地逐行检查源代码,以确保所有语句都是正确的,并按预期执行。技术宅论坛源码
使用打印语句:在代码中插入打印(或日志)语句,以便在运行时显示变量的值和程序的状态。这有助于追踪程序的行为。
单元测试:编写单元测试来自动化测试代码的各个部分。单元测试可以帮助您确认每个函数或模块按照预期工作。
断言:使用断言来验证代码的关键部分是否满足特定条件。如果条件不满足,程序会抛出错误,这有助于快速定位问题。任务脚本源码
集成测试:在单元测试之后,进行集成测试以确保代码的不同部分能够良好地协同工作。
使用调试工具:大多数IDE(集成开发环境)都包含调试器,它们允许您逐步执行代码,检查变量的值,设置断点,以及评估表达式。
代码审查:让其他开发人员审查你的代码也是一种很好的做法。新的视角可能会发现你没注意到的问题。
记录和分析错误消息:当程序崩溃或出现错误时,仔细阅读错误消息,它们往往会告诉你哪里出了问题。
隔离问题:通过注释掉代码或构建简化的测试案例,将问题局限在较小的范围内,这样可以更容易地识别问题所在。
搜索和替换:如果怀疑某个类型的错误(例如拼写错误),可以使用搜索和替换功能在整个代码库中查找可能的问题。
检查外部依赖:确保所有外部资源(如数据库、API服务、文件等)均正常工作,并且被正确配置。
回滚代码:如果引入新代码后出现问题,考虑回滚到早期的工作版本,然后逐步引入更改以找出问题所在。
保持冷静:面对难以诊断的错误时,保持耐心和冷静,休息片刻再返回问题,有时候能有新的发现。
利用社区力量:如果自己解决不了问题,可以在Stack Overflow、GitHub、Reddit等社区寻求帮助。描述清楚问题,并提供相关代码片段。
记住,调试是一个逐步缩小问题范围的过程。耐心和细致是关键。